The human-like driving system is an essential technical way to improve the applicability and acceptance of an unmanned driving system by learning the knowledge and experience of human drivers. In order to solve the driving skills representation problem at trajectory and control level, by utilizing a large amount of collected real driving data, a hierarchical driver model based on trajectory primitives and operation primitives is proposed. The trajectory primitives are represented by the dynamic movement primitive, and the probabilistic extraction algorithm is applied to extract primitives from the unlabeled continuous trajectory data.
